#1e60bd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1e60bd is composed of 11.8% red, 37.6% green and 74.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.1% cyan, 49.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 215.1 degrees, a saturation of 72.6% and a lightness of 42.9%. #1e60bd color hex could be obtained by blending #3cc0ff with #00007b.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

#1e60bd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1e60bd has RGB values of R:30, G:96, B:189 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0.49, Y:0, K:0.26. Its decimal value is 1990845.

Shades and Tints of #1e60bd
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000103 is the darkest color, while #f1f6f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e60bd
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6a6d71 is the less saturated color, while #055cd6 is the most saturated one.
